Should anyone need to report cars obstructing the pavement on Woodcombe Crescent (and by obstructing I mean blocking the entire right of way).

You may find this number for Lewisham Council helpful - 020 8297 3599 - as it took me sometime to find and get through to the appropriate Dept.
